What is $774,500 After Taxes in Colorado?

A $774,500 salary in Colorado takes home $475,068 after federal income tax, state income tax, and FICA — a 38.7% effective tax rate.

Full Tax Breakdown — $774,500 in Colorado (Single Filer)

Tax ItemAmountRate
Gross Salary$774,500
Federal Income Tax$238,03530.7%
CO State Income Tax$34,0784.4%
Social Security (6.2%)$10,9181.4%
Medicare (1.45%+)$16,4012.1%
Total Taxes$299,43238.7%
Take-Home Pay$475,06861.3%

Colorado Tax Overview

Colorado uses a flat 4.40% income tax rate applied to all taxable income, regardless of earnings level. The simplicity means a $50,000 earner and a $200,000 earner pay the exact same marginal rate — a design that favors higher earners compared to graduated bracket systems.
